Chandler lands on Associated Press Little All-American Second Team
SALISBURY, Md. - Salisbury University senior defensive end Jarrell Chandler was named to the prestigious Associated Press Little All-American second team on Friday. This is the first time Chandler has been named to this team.
The AP Little All-American Teams includes players from NCAA Division II, III and the NAIA.
This is Chandler's second All-American honor this year as he was recently named to the American Football Coaches Association (AFCA) Division III All-American First Team.
Chandler had an outstanding year for the Sea Gulls (9-2). The 2008
All-South Region first team selection ranks fourth in the nation
for tackles for loss average per game (2.15) and 15th in the nation
for sacks per game (0.95). The Salisbury, Md., product is ranked
sixth in the ACFC in tackles (64) and tackles per game (6.40).
While being honored to the 2008 All-ACFC first team, he was tied
for first in sacks (9.5). Chandler also leads the ACFC in tackles
for loss average per game and is second in tackle for loss yards
(90).
Chandler is one of two players from the Atlantic Central Football Conference (ACFC) to earn a spot on the AP Little All-American Teams. Wesley College's Larry Beavers was named to the second team offense as the all-purpose player.
